On Fri, Jun 20, 2003 at 10:00:12AM -0700, Dennis Gearon wrote: > That's a good, mabye better model! > ... > >I disagree. I think what PostgreSQL really needs is a few companies > >who are willing to underwrite a developer or two a piece. Or, maybe > >more precisely, _several_ companies to do that. The only thing > >currently missing in the community, therefore, is the "several" part, > >IMO. There are some, but I still disagree. The biggest advantage of PostgreSQL in my opinion has always been that it's a community project and not driven by some commercial interests. I also do not agree that IBM is so important for Linux. IBM helps yes, but there's also a huge risk. Paying people unselfishly to do community work is a very difficult business model. It's different if some companies are willing to pay for some improvements on PGSQL because they want to use it. This is a valid business decision. And the companies with the PGSQL developers can handle these contracts and generate some profit.
